Ho fatto alcune tabelle "temporanee" che saranno riempite con i dati di una registrazione e poi questi dati li inviero' tutti in una tabella finale.
Quello che voglio capire e' come posso recuperare tutti i dati in modo piu' veloce possibile, cioe' posso evitare di fare il ciclo while?
Io avevo pensato una cosa tipo:
$sql = "select * from fatture where id_hotel = \"$id_hotel\"";
$risultato = @mysql_query($sql,$connessione)
or die("Impossibile eseguire l'interrogazione.");
$sql2 = "select * from temp_dati_hotel where id_hotel = \"$id_hotel\"";
$risultato2 = @mysql_query($sql2,$connessione)
or die("Impossibile eseguire l'interrogazione.");
$sql3 = "select * from temp_foto where id_hotel = \"$id_hotel\"";
$risultato3 = @mysql_query($sql3,$connessione)
or die("Impossibile eseguire l'interrogazione.");
$sql4 = "select * from temp_info_hotel where id_hotel = \"$id_hotel\"";
$risultato4 = @mysql_query($sql4,$connessione)
or die("Impossibile eseguire l'interrogazione.");
$sql5 = "select * from temp_servizi where id_hotel = \"$id_hotel\"";
$risultato5 = @mysql_query($sql5,$connessione)
or die("Impossibile eseguire l'interrogazione.");
e poi sotto faccio una query che inserisce tutti questi dati nella tabella chiamata DATI.
Qualche consiglio per velocizzare il tutto lo avete?